Webster's 1913 Dictionary

HAVERSACK

Hav "er *sack, n. Etym: [F. havresac, G. habersack, sack for oats. See 2d Haver, and Sack a bag. ]

 

1. A bag for oats or oatmeal. [Prov. Eng. ]

 

2. A bag or case, usually of stout cloth, in which a soldier carries his rations when on a march; -- distinguished from knapsack.

 

3. A gunner's case or bag used carry cartridges from the ammunition chest to the piece in loading.

 

New American Oxford Dictionary

haversack

hav er sack |ˈhavərˌsak ˈhævərˌsæk | noun a small, sturdy bag carried on the back or over the shoulder, used esp. by soldiers and hikers. ORIGIN mid 18th cent.: from French havresac, from obsolete German Habersack, denoting a bag used by soldiers to carry oats as horse feed, from dialect Haber oats + Sack sack, bag.
